Ours broke on our ae100. I used a crowbar to get it open. Although I don't usually use a crowbar on jobs like this, this was the only way I could see getting it open.

The little handle thing that controls the locking pin is pretty common. I got one from a 84 Corrola from pick-a-part. The only difference is it may have a different trim. They are easy enough to get in and out.
